Abstract

The application relates to a comprehensive wiring and routing fixing device for intelligent engineering installation, which comprises a plurality of mounting plates, wherein a pair of concave cavities are formed in the tops of the mounting plates, a wire releasing panel is fixedly connected to the inner side wall of each concave cavity, wire clamping components are arranged inside each concave cavity and comprise a pair of two-way threaded rods rotatably connected to the inner side wall of each concave cavity, a pair of sliders are respectively in threaded connection with the outer surfaces of the two-way threaded rods, supporting blocks are fixedly connected to the tops of the sliders and are slidably connected into guide grooves formed in the tops of the wire releasing panels, clamping mechanisms are arranged at the tops of the supporting blocks, rotating shafts are rotatably connected to the sides of the mounting plates and extend to the insides of the mounting plates and are fixedly connected with the two-way threaded rods, so that the mounting plates can fixedly install cables of different sizes and models, and further improve the wiring efficiency of the mounting plates, and flexibility in securing cables.

Technical Field
The application relates to the technical field of devices for cable wiring, in particular to a comprehensive wiring and wiring fixing device for intelligent engineering installation.
Background
The intelligent engineering often refers to a series of electronic equipment installed in some buildings, such as monitors, entrance guards, automatic fire alarms and the like, before the electronic equipment is installed, the circuit of the equipment is often wired in advance, the electronic equipment is convenient to be electrified, and a wiring and routing fixing device is often used in the wiring process to fix and distribute circuits of cables of the equipment.
However, in the conventional wiring and routing fixing device, usually, a cable routing groove is formed in an installation panel, a cable is placed in the groove, and then the installation panel is fixed on a wall body through a bolt. Referring to fig. 1-4, a comprehensive wiring and routing fixing device for intelligent engineering installation comprises a plurality of mounting plates 1, a plurality of wiring holes are arranged on the side surface of each mounting plate 1, a pair of concave cavities 2 are arranged on the top of each mounting plate 1, a routing panel 3 is fixedly connected to the inner side wall of each concave cavity 2, a wiring clamping component is arranged inside each concave cavity 2 and comprises a pair of bidirectional threaded rods 4 rotatably connected to the inner side wall of each concave cavity 2, the two bidirectional threaded rods 4 are fixedly connected, the thread teeth of the bidirectional threaded rods 4 are symmetrically arranged, a pair of sliders 5 are respectively and threadedly connected to the outer surfaces of the two bidirectional threaded rods 4, supporting blocks 6 are fixedly connected to the tops of the sliders 5, the supporting blocks 6 are slidably connected into guide grooves formed in the tops of the routing panels 3, clamping mechanisms are arranged on the tops of the supporting blocks 6, and two clamping mechanisms are correspondingly arranged in a group, the side surface of the mounting plate 1 is rotatably connected with a rotating shaft 7, the rotating shaft 7 extends into the mounting plate 1 and is fixedly connected with a bidirectional threaded rod 4, cables of different types are firstly distinguished, the distinguished cables respectively pass through the mounting plate 1 to contact with clamping mechanisms on two concave cavities 2 for classified wiring, then the bidirectional threaded rod 4 is rotated by sequentially rotating the rotating shaft 7, the bidirectional threaded rod 4 is rotated to enable two sliders 5 to move close to each other, the two sliders 5 move close to each other, two supporting blocks 6 drive the two clamping mechanisms to mutually close to clamp and fix the cables, wiring fixation of the cables is completed, distance between the two clamping mechanisms can be adjusted and controlled, the mounting plate 1 can mount and fix the cables of different sizes, wiring efficiency of the mounting plate 1 is improved, and flexibility of fixing the cables is improved, the side end of the rotating shaft 7 is fixedly connected with a rotating disc 8, the rotating disc 8 is arranged to facilitate a user to rotate the rotating shaft 7, the clamping mechanism comprises a connecting block 9 fixedly connected to the top of the supporting block 6, the side surface of the connecting block 9 is fixedly connected with an arc-shaped clamping plate 11 through a spring 10, when the clamping mechanism is used, the two connecting blocks 9 are close to each other, the two arc-shaped clamping plates 11 are close to each other to clamp and fix the cable, meanwhile, the arc-shaped clamping plates 11 are fixedly connected to the connecting block 9 through the spring 10, when the cable is extruded by the arc-shaped clamping plates 11, the connecting block 9 is buffered, further, when the cable is clamped by the two arc-shaped clamping plates 11, the cable cannot be clamped, one side of the arc-shaped clamping plate 11, opposite to the connecting block 9, is fixedly connected with a pair of guide bars 12, the guide bars 12 are slidably connected to the middle part of the connecting block 9, and the guide bars 12 arranged on the arc-shaped clamping plates 11 can enable the arc-shaped clamping plates 11 to move on the connecting block 9, inject it, the orbit can not take place the skew when guaranteeing the buffering of arc cardboard 11, and then stability when having guaranteed the 11 joint cables of arc cardboard, it has sheltering from panel 13 to peg graft at the top of mounting panel 1, through connecting backing plate 14 joints between two mounting panels 1, and a plurality of mounting holes are seted up to the bottom of mounting panel 1, shelter from panel 13's setting, can carry out the closing cap to it after the cable wiring is accomplished, ensure that outside impurity can't get into in the mounting panel 1.
The implementation principle of the comprehensive wiring and wiring fixing device for the intelligent engineering installation is as follows: firstly, a user fixes a mounting plate 1 on an external wall body through a bolt, then distinguishes cables of different types, the distinguished cables respectively pass through the mounting plate 1 to contact with clamping mechanisms on two concave cavities 2 for classified wiring, then rotates a two-way threaded rod 4 through sequentially rotating a rotating shaft 7, the two-way threaded rod 4 rotates to enable two sliders 5 to move close to each other, the two sliders 5 move close to each other, two supporting blocks 6 drive two connecting blocks 9 to close to each other, the two connecting blocks 9 are close to each other, two arc-shaped clamping plates 11 are close to each other to clamp and fix the cables, when the rotating shaft 7 is sequentially rotated, the rotating period of the rotating shaft can be adjusted according to the cables of different types, meanwhile, the arc-shaped clamping plates 11 are fixedly connected on the connecting blocks 9 through springs 10, so that the arc-shaped clamping plates 11 have a buffering function towards the connecting blocks 9 when extruding the cables, and then ensured that two arc cardboard 11 can not press from both sides bad cable when the joint cable to reach the cable that this fixing device can satisfy different models and walk the fixed effect of line simultaneously.
